IJMHS is committed to upholding the highest standards of research and publication ethics. All parties must adhere to principles of integrity, accountability, fairness, and respect.
Authorship must be based on substantial contributions (ICMJE criteria).
Ghost, guest, and gift authorship are prohibited.
Changes in authorship require written consent from all authors.
Only original, unpublished work is considered.
Plagiarism and redundant/duplicate publication are prohibited.
Fabrication and falsification are unacceptable.
IJMHS strongly encourages data sharing in public repositories. A Data Availability Statement is required.
Clinical trial data must be shared in accordance with ICMJE guidelines.
All authors, reviewers, and editors must disclose any conflicts of interest.
A declaration of COI must be included in the manuscript.
Human Participants: Studies must comply with the Declaration of Helsinki, have IRB approval, and obtain documented informed consent.
Animal Subjects: Studies must comply with institutional, national, and international guidelines (e.g., ARRIVE) and have IACUC/ethical approval.
Clinical Trials: Registration in a public trials registry is mandatory before participant enrollment.
Reviewers must maintain confidentiality, objectivity, and timeliness.
Reviewers must declare conflicts of interest.
Corrections, retractions, and expressions of concern will be issued as necessary, following COPE guidelines.
Allegations are investigated following COPE guidelines, potentially involving author institutions.
Outcomes may include rejection, retraction, or notification of relevant bodies.
